01 | present time, 2032 [lance]

ONE

LANCE EVANS HAS daddy issues. Sure, his father is the mayor of the city and with that said, he is definitely better off as compared to his classmates. Like, better off as in richer; more privileged. But that doesn't mean he is a daddy's boy. He likes to think that he's far from it, actually. The thought of being one is cringe-worthy. Anyway, back to the subject at hand. He has daddy issues. Right.

Lance likes to believe that having a more privileged life is, in no way, equivalent to having better relationships. In fact, he is absolutely certain that money spoils relationships. Even if it has the ability to make you happy. It doesn't make him happy, for the record. Money is, in factual (or not) terms, greed and greed is nowhere near good, even if both words start with the same letter.

With Gabriel Evans, the person Lance has daddy issues with, money comes pouring in quickly. Rise of economy? More money. Trades from overseas businessmen? More money. As long as the city prospers, money will come rolling into the pockets of Gabriel Evans. And the citizens' pockets, of course.

If you think that Gabriel Evans, having earned more money, would give Lance more allowance, then you are, sadly, mistaken. Lance, to Gabriel Evans, is a sort of investment. Brutal statement, but it's the truth. Cold, hard truth, if you may.

There's never a time when Gabriel Evans would tell Lance to 'take a break'. Because investments don't ever take breaks. You either rise or you fall. And in Gabriel Evans' dictionary (one that Lance desperately wants to burn away, if he could), you can never find the word 'fall'. A reason why the city is constantly prospering, actually. Rise, rise and rise, but never fall. Falling, to Gabriel Evans, is a sin and, while it is applicable to the city he's in-charge of, it is definitely also applicable to his son, Lance.

The extra income Gabriel Evans has, will be the extra amount of money used to, well, invest in Lance. Invest his hopes and dreams in Lance by signing his son up for more courses, activities and whatever. As if the ones he's already being signed up for aren't enough. To say that Lance's weekly schedules are packed would be the understatement of his entire life. Not that Gabriel Evans would care. He doesn't care about his son's mental well-being.

And, to make matters worse, he's strict when it comes to his son. Afraid that his son would defy him by sneaking away from any courses, activities, or whatever, Gabriel Evans does what every rich person would do – employ a chauffeur and personal assistant for Lance. Lance thinks that he is simply spending away unnecessary money. One would say that he is merely making his son's life easier and ensuring that his son will be protected (from what though?) at all times, but Lance knows better.

The chauffeur and personal assistant are not there to ensure his safety and whatnot. They are there to keep an eye on him and are the people who would control and watch his every move for as long as Gabriel Evans is not around; for as long as he, Lance, is not in the same place as Gabriel Evans. Which is annoying, really, but he can't do anything about it. That doesn't mean he hasn't tried doing anything about it, though.

He has. Numerous times, in fact. But what did Gabriel Evans do? Well, he either 1) goes into the role of Elsa from Frozen and shut Lance out (which, in this case, Lance is literally Anna) or, 2) tells Lance to act his age and stop whining when he has responsibilities to ... what was that term again? Oh, yes, uphold. That also doesn't mean that Lance didn't try and defend himself. Or rather, talk back (as adults love to put it).

Lance's exact words to Gabriel Evans were, quoting him, "Mum wouldn't treat me like that, nor would she allow you to treat me like that!" That, admittedly, is a rather interesting retort, although no one knows whether it is true or not. It was a low move, Lance knew, because topics regarding his mother are generally avoided at all cost, something Lance will never, ever understand why. It's not as though Gabriel Evans has ever talked to Lance about her. Though Lance wished he did.

But it wasn't as though Gabriel Evans gave two damns about what Lance said. Okay, actually, maybe he did, because he was rather affected by it. And by affected, Lance meant that Gabriel Evans got angry and mad at him. Not that it's anything new, of course.

It then led to Gabriel Evans asking Lance's personal assistant, Thea Holland, to escort Lance back to his room. It was a useless command because 1) Lance has been living in this godforsaken mansion (or whatever this huge, stupid place is called) for years and he surely knows where the hell his room is, and is thus able to get there without anyone's help and, 2) totally no offense intended (questionable) but – why not just escort him out of the house so he won't ever have to deal with this nonsense anymore?

So, yes, in case of point, Lance Evans indeed has daddy issues with the one and only insufferable Gabriel escort-him-back-to-his-room Evans.

(He doesn't hate his father).

(Okay, questionable).

(But maybe 'dislike' would suffice because hate is a strong word).

"Lance? Your favorite father would like to see you in his office."

"Nice," Lance says without taking his eyes off his comic book. "But I'm kind of occupied right now so maybe another time, yeah? Besides, I don't see why there's any need for him to want to see me, especially when I have diligently attended every single class I'm supposed to for the week, even for the ones I hate."

A sigh. Lance finally looks up. "Am I wrong, Elton?"

"He loves you," the youngest hired helper (or whatever Gabriel Evans call them), the one whom Lance is closest to, fires back evenly. "He just doesn't know how to express it."

"Then he should totally work on expressing it in the correct way."

"I'll debate with you on this another day. He really wants to see you right now. Seems rather important, from the looks of it, because he looks a little distraught."

"Now," Lance forms an imaginary rainbow with his two hands in front of him, "say it with me. Kar-ma. Karma."

"Karma?" Elton says cluelessly while dragging Lance out of his room. "Also, are you trying to copy the Spongebob rainbow meme or something?"

"No, you got to say it confidently. Don't say it with a question mark at the end. Either say it with a full stop or, the better option, an exclamation mark. And no, I'm not trying to copy that meme. I'm original."

"You're bullshit, kiddo. Let's go see your dad now."

"You owe me," Lance crosses his arms as he stands outside Gabriel Evans' office. "For dragging me here and for not saying the word 'karma' like how you're supposed to."

Shrugging without a care for what Lance has just said, Elton knocks on the office's door, opens it, then pushes Lance inside. And after he does so, with Lance glaring at him before he closes the door, he mouths 'have fun' to the grumpy-looking boy.

• • •

"Father," Lance greets frostily, "heard you've asked for me."

"Yes, I did. Do take a seat."

"No thanks, I'm comfortable with just standing."

"Sure. I'll cut this meeting as short as I can, because I do have lots of paperwork to deal with."

Lance chokes back a laugh. Even if Gabriel Evans having tons of paperwork to settle is a true thing, Lance knows it is only a coverage. A coverage for the actual reason as to why Gabriel Evans wants to end this discussion as soon as possible. Because the tension in this room is unbearable. Because nothing feels right and normal when the both of them are confined in the very same space, breathing the very same air. Because when the both of them engage in a conversation, it's only formal communication. Like, a businessman to a businessman kind of talk.

"So, Lance, I'm sure you do know that the crime rates these days are getting higher and higher because it's becoming more frequent."

"Yes." Lance wonders briefly if Gabriel Evans is actually going to ask him to be a cop.

"And I'm certain you know who's the cause of this."

"Yes. Estelle Granger. Estelle Quinn Granger, for full name purposes. Commits crimes, including murders, without the need of an alter-ego. She, along with her crew, are criminals whom the cops have difficulty tracking till now. Am I correct, Father?"

"Yes," Gabriel Evans stands up and gazes at the city through the clear glass windows, looking slightly distracted for a moment. "And because there's absolutely no way we can stop them, I have resorted to the final solution."

"Cool. That's great to hear. Although, I still don't understand my purpose of being here."

"I believe you know who Alex Walker is. The renowned scientist in the city. Recently, I have approached him with hopes that he would be able to help assist in this ... mission, as I would refer it, and I was certainly pleased when he presented his time machine to me. His best creation yet."

"Exciting," Lance deadpans.

"He has allowed me to use the time machine after much persuasion and I've decided to use the time machine to stop Estelle Quinn Granger and her crew. Actually, just Estelle Quinn Granger. You will go all the way back to the past, to the day Estelle Quinn Granger is planning to become a villain again, and stop her from considering that option of becoming one."

"Wait, I'm sorry, but did you just say that I will be the one time-traveling back in time?"

"Yes."

"Wait, what? You can't just send me back in time! I refuse to go back in time just to stop Estelle Quinn Granger from choosing the villain path. Are you insane? Look, I- I have classes to attend. I still have school-"

"You're homeschooled. Classes can be rearranged."

"You seriously cannot do this to me," Lance increases his voice in desperation. "Why do I not have a say in this? Why can't you be the one doing so? I barely know Estelle Quinn Granger. She's of the same age as you, if I remembered correctly, so why can't you be the one going back in time?"

"As the mayor of the city, I have responsibilities to take care of."

"You can't just blatantly disregard my opinion on this. I should have a say in this, Father. Don't you think it's wrong of you to just decide this for me?"

"No, not really. Before I dismiss you-"

"You are not dismissing me from this discussion. Don't you realize how unreasonable you are being right now? When have you ever, for a second, considered my feelings and opinions? I can let the previous matters slide but this? I can't bring myself to."

"Lance Evans," Gabriel Evans snaps at last, eyes narrowing as Lance glares at him fiercely. "You have zero say in this. Take this proposal along with you and leave my office this instant."

Lance storms to the mahogany desk, eyes blazing as he snatches the proposal from Gabriel Evans' hands. "With fucking pleasure," he curses, earning a shock expression from Gabriel Evans, before leaving the office and, of course, making sure to slam the door loudly on his way out.

"Well," Elton chuckles next to the fuming Lance as the two walked back to Lance's room, "I assumed you've had fun."

"Wouldn't fault you for your assumption. In fact, it's probably the most fun I've had in a long time," Lance retorts sullenly, crumpling the side of the proposal.
